The Fall Festival charges $0.75 per ticket for the rides. Kendall bought 18 tickets for rides and spent a total of $33.50 at the festival. She only spent her money on ride tickets and admission into the festival. The price of admission is the same for everyone. Use y to represent the total cost and x to represent the number of ride tickets.
(a) Define your variables.
(b) Write a linear equation to calculate the cost for anyone who only pays for festival admission and rides
(c) Explain your answer to Part B.
Step-by-step explanation:
The Fall Festival charges $0.75 per ticket for the rides. Kendall bought 18 tickets for rides and spent a total of $33.50 at the festival
0.75 per ticket. So cost of 18 tickets= 0.75 * 18 = $13.5
Kendall spent $13.50 for tickets . Total spent = $33.50
Total spent = ticket cost + admission cost
33.50 = 13.50 + admission
Admission cost = 33.50 - 13.50 = $20
(a) y to represent the total cost , x to represent the number of ride tickets.
'b' represents the admission cost
(b) General form of linear equation is y=mx+b
m = 0.75 and b = admission cost = 20
So equation becomes y = 0.75x + 20
(c) Initially, she has to pay the admission price $20. then 0.75 per ticket.
The value of x changes depends on the number of tickets she wants to buy.
y is the total cost she has to pay for x tickets with admission price

Barbara drives between Miami, Florida, and West Palm Beach, Florida. She drives 50 mi in clear weather and then encounters a thunderstorm for the last 16 mi. She drives 18 mi slower through the thunderstorm than she does in clear weather. If the total time for the trip is 1.5 hr, determine her speed driving in nice weather and her speed driving in the thunderstorm.
Answer:
Her speed driving in nice weather is 50 mph and in thunderstorm is 32 mph.
Step-by-step explanation:
Barbara drives 50 miles in clear weather and then encounters a thunderstorm for the last 16 miles.
Suppose, her speed in nice weather is [tex]x[/tex] mph.
As she drives 18 mph slower through the thunderstorm than she does in clear weather, so her speed in thunderstorm will be: [tex](x-18) mph[/tex]
We know that, [tex]Time = \frac{Distance}{Speed}[/tex]
So, the time of driving in clear weather [tex]=\frac{50}{x}[/tex] hours
and the time of driving in thunderstorm [tex]=\frac{16}{x-18}[/tex] hours.
Given that, the total time for the trip is 1.5 hours. So, the equation will be......
[tex]\frac{50}{x}+ \frac{16}{x-18}=1.5 \\ \\ \frac{50x-900+16x}{x(x-18)}=1.5\\ \\ \frac{66x-900}{x(x-18)}=1.5 \\ \\ 1.5x(x-18)=66x-900\\ \\ 1.5x^2-27x=66x-900\\ \\ 1.5x^2-93x+900=0\\ \\ 1.5(x^2 -62x+600)=0\\ \\ x^2 -62x+600=0\\ \\ (x-50)(x-12)=0[/tex]
Using zero-product property.........
[tex]x-50=0\\ x=50\\ \\ and\\ \\ x-12=0\\ x=12[/tex]
We need to ignore [tex]x=12[/tex] here, otherwise the speed in thunderstorm will become negative.
So, her speed driving in nice weather is 50 mph and her speed driving in thunderstorm is (50-18) = 32 mph

Is |-6| a negative integer
Answer:
NO. |-6| = 6 - a positive integer
Step-by-step explanation:
|a| = a for a ≥ 0
examples
|2| = 2, |0| = 0, |0.56| = 0.56
|a| = -a for a < 0
examples
|-2| = -(-2) = 2, |-100| = -(-100) = 100, |-0.25| = 0.25
Therefore your answer:
|-6| = 6 > 0
